Closed Bug 1129538 Opened 9 years ago Closed 9 years ago

Intermittent test_draggableprop.html,test_richtext2.html | application crashed [@ mozalloc_abort(char const*)] after "ABORT: Should have given mProgressTracker to mImage: '!mProgressTracker', file /image/src/imgRequest.cpp, line 149"

Categories

(Core :: Graphics: ImageLib, defect)

x86_64
macOS
defect
Not set
normal

Tracking

()

RESOLVED WORKSFORME
mozilla39
Tracking Status
firefox37 --- wontfix
firefox38 --- affected
firefox39 --- fixed
firefox-esr31 --- unaffected
firefox-esr38 --- affected
b2g-v2.2 --- affected
b2g-master --- fixed

People

(Reporter: RyanVM, Assigned: seth)

References

Details

(Keywords: assertion, crash, intermittent-failure)

05:57:39 INFO - 330 INFO TEST-START | dom/events/test/test_draggableprop.html
05:57:39 INFO - ++DOMWINDOW == 100 (0x10e333800) [pid = 3530] [serial = 514] [outer = 0x122f6ac00]
05:57:39 INFO - [Parent 3530] WARNING: NS_ENSURE_SUCCESS(rv, BadImage(newImage)) failed with result 0x80004005: file /builds/slave/fx-team-osx64-d-00000000000000/build/src/image/src/ImageFactory.cpp, line 205
05:57:39 INFO - [Parent 3530] ###!!! ABORT: Should have given mProgressTracker to mImage: '!mProgressTracker', file /builds/slave/fx-team-osx64-d-00000000000000/build/src/image/src/imgRequest.cpp, line 149
05:57:57 INFO - #01: imgRequest::AdjustPriority(imgRequestProxy*, int) [mfbt/AlreadyAddRefed.h:109]
05:57:57 INFO - #02: imgRequestProxy::AdjustPriority(int) [image/src/imgRequestProxy.cpp:697]
05:57:57 INFO - #03: nsLoadGroup::RemoveRequest(nsIRequest*, nsISupports*, nsresult) [xpcom/glue/nsCOMPtr.h:389]
05:57:57 INFO - #04: imgRequestProxy::RemoveFromLoadGroup(bool) [image/src/imgRequestProxy.cpp:256]
05:57:57 INFO - #05: nsRunnableMethodImpl<void (imgRequestProxy::*)(), void, true>::Run() [xpcom/glue/nsThreadUtils.h:386]
05:57:57 INFO - #06: nsThread::ProcessNextEvent(bool, bool*) [xpcom/threads/nsThread.cpp:855]
05:57:57 INFO - #07: NS_ProcessPendingEvents(nsIThread*, unsigned int) [xpcom/glue/nsThreadUtils.cpp:207]
05:57:57 INFO - #08: nsBaseAppShell::NativeEventCallback() [widget/nsBaseAppShell.cpp:99]
05:57:57 INFO - #09: nsAppShell::ProcessGeckoEvents(void*) [widget/cocoa/nsAppShell.mm:374]
05:57:57 INFO - #10: CoreFoundation + 0x12841
05:57:57 INFO - #11: CoreFoundation + 0x12165
05:57:57 INFO - #12: CoreFoundation + 0x354e5
05:57:57 INFO - #13: CoreFoundation + 0x34dd2
05:57:57 INFO - #14: HIToolbox + 0x5f774
05:57:57 INFO - #15: HIToolbox + 0x5f512
05:57:57 INFO - #16: HIToolbox + 0x5f3a3
05:57:57 INFO - #17: AppKit + 0x156fa3
05:57:57 INFO - #18: AppKit + 0x156862
05:57:57 INFO - #19: -[GeckoNSApplication nextEventMatchingMask:untilDate:inMode:dequeue:] [widget/cocoa/nsAppShell.mm:118]
05:57:57 INFO - #20: AppKit + 0x14dc03
05:57:57 INFO - #21: nsAppShell::Run() [xpcom/glue/nsCOMPtr.h:512]
05:57:57 INFO - #22: nsAppStartup::Run() [toolkit/components/startup/nsAppStartup.cpp:281]
05:57:57 INFO - #23: XREMain::XRE_mainRun() [toolkit/xre/nsAppRunner.cpp:4160]
05:57:57 INFO - #24: XREMain::XRE_main(int, char**, nsXREAppData const*) [toolkit/xre/nsAppRunner.cpp:4236]
05:57:57 INFO - #25: XRE_main [toolkit/xre/nsAppRunner.cpp:4456]
05:57:57 INFO - #26: main [browser/app/nsBrowserApp.cpp:294]
05:57:57 INFO - [Parent 3530] ###!!! ABORT: Should have given mProgressTracker to mImage: '!mProgressTracker', file /builds/slave/fx-team-osx64-d-00000000000000/build/src/image/src/imgRequest.cpp, line 149
05:57:57 INFO - Hit MOZ_CRASH() at /builds/slave/fx-team-osx64-d-00000000000000/build/src/memory/mozalloc/mozalloc_abort.cpp:37
05:57:57 INFO - TEST-INFO | Main app process: killed by SIGHUP 
05:57:58 INFO - 491 ERROR TEST-UNEXPECTED-FAIL | dom/events/test/test_draggableprop.html | application terminated with exit code 1
05:57:58 INFO - runtests.py | Application ran for: 0:03:12.504972
05:57:58 INFO - zombiecheck | Reading PID log: /var/folders/h4/whqdbjcj54z8qxp116x5c_6800000w/T/tmpqTQCOvpidlog
05:58:14 INFO - mozcrash Saved minidump as /builds/slave/talos-slave/test/build/blobber_upload_dir/AFB457AF-2F8D-4B0D-9612-B4EEC3911AA4.dmp
05:58:14 INFO - mozcrash Saved app info as /builds/slave/talos-slave/test/build/blobber_upload_dir/AFB457AF-2F8D-4B0D-9612-B4EEC3911AA4.extra
05:58:14 WARNING - PROCESS-CRASH | dom/events/test/test_draggableprop.html | application crashed [@ mozalloc_abort(char const*)]
05:58:14 INFO - Crash dump filename: /var/folders/h4/whqdbjcj54z8qxp116x5c_6800000w/T/tmp9Fkrhn.mozrunner/minidumps/AFB457AF-2F8D-4B0D-9612-B4EEC3911AA4.dmp
05:58:14 INFO - Operating system: Mac OS X
05:58:14 INFO - 10.8.0 12A269
05:58:14 INFO - CPU: amd64
05:58:14 INFO - family 6 model 42 stepping 7
05:58:14 INFO - 8 CPUs
05:58:14 INFO - Crash reason: EXC_BAD_ACCESS / KERN_INVALID_ADDRESS
05:58:14 INFO - Crash address: 0x0
05:58:14 INFO - Thread 0 (crashed)
05:58:14 INFO - 0 libmozalloc.dylib!mozalloc_abort(char const*) [mozalloc_abort.cpp:76666ba94d14 : 37 + 0x0]
05:58:14 INFO - rbx = 0x00007fff7cd36c68 r12 = 0x00007fff5fbfc970
05:58:14 INFO - r13 = 0x0000000000000003 r14 = 0x00007fff5fbfc990
05:58:14 INFO - r15 = 0x00007fff5fbfc980 rip = 0x00000001000cca01
05:58:14 INFO - rsp = 0x00007fff5fbfc910 rbp = 0x00007fff5fbfc920
05:58:14 INFO - Found by: given as instruction pointer in context
05:58:14 INFO - 1 XUL!Abort [nsDebugImpl.cpp:76666ba94d14 : 469 + 0x4]
05:58:14 INFO - rbx = 0x00007fff5fbfc960 r12 = 0x00007fff5fbfc970
05:58:14 INFO - r13 = 0x0000000000000003 r14 = 0x00007fff5fbfc990
05:58:14 INFO - r15 = 0x00007fff5fbfc980 rip = 0x0000000101479c79
05:58:14 INFO - rsp = 0x00007fff5fbfc930 rbp = 0x00007fff5fbfc930
05:58:14 INFO - Found by: call frame info
05:58:14 INFO - 2 XUL!NS_DebugBreak [nsDebugImpl.cpp:76666ba94d14 : 426 + 0x4]
05:58:14 INFO - rbx = 0x00007fff5fbfc960 r12 = 0x00007fff5fbfc970
05:58:14 INFO - r13 = 0x0000000000000003 r14 = 0x00007fff5fbfc990
05:58:14 INFO - r15 = 0x00007fff5fbfc980 rip = 0x0000000101479a06
05:58:14 INFO - rsp = 0x00007fff5fbfc940 rbp = 0x00007fff5fbfcdb0
05:58:14 INFO - Found by: call frame info
05:58:14 INFO - 3 XUL!imgRequest::GetProgressTracker() [imgRequest.cpp:76666ba94d14 : 148 + 0x24]
05:58:14 INFO - rbx = 0x000000013267e4c0 r12 = 0x0000000132693b00
05:58:14 INFO - r13 = 0x00000000ffffffff r14 = 0x00007fff5fbfcdf8
05:58:14 INFO - r15 = 0x0000000132693b00 rip = 0x00000001020c6bc7
05:58:14 INFO - rsp = 0x00007fff5fbfcdc0 rbp = 0x00007fff5fbfcde0
05:58:14 INFO - Found by: call frame info
05:58:14 INFO - 4 XUL!imgRequest::AdjustPriority(imgRequestProxy*, int) [imgRequest.cpp:76666ba94d14 : 444 + 0x7]
05:58:14 INFO - rbx = 0x0000000132662700 r12 = 0x0000000132693b00
05:58:14 INFO - r13 = 0x00000000ffffffff r14 = 0x00000000ffffffff
05:58:14 INFO - r15 = 0x0000000132662700 rip = 0x00000001020c7dd4
05:58:14 INFO - rsp = 0x00007fff5fbfcdf0 rbp = 0x00007fff5fbfce30
05:58:14 INFO - Found by: call frame info
05:58:14 INFO - 5 XUL!imgRequestProxy::AdjustPriority(int) [imgRequestProxy.cpp:76666ba94d14 : 697 + 0xd]
05:58:14 INFO - rbx = 0x0000000132662700 r12 = 0x00000001225b64e0
05:58:14 INFO - r13 = 0x00000000ffffffff r14 = 0x00000000ffffffff
05:58:14 INFO - r15 = 0x0000000132662700 rip = 0x00000001020ce700
05:58:14 INFO - rsp = 0x00007fff5fbfce40 rbp = 0x00007fff5fbfce50
05:58:14 INFO - Found by: call frame info
05:58:14 INFO - 6 XUL!nsLoadGroup::RemoveRequest(nsIRequest*, nsISupports*, nsresult) [nsLoadGroup.cpp:76666ba94d14 : 99 + 0x8]
05:58:14 INFO - rbx = 0x0000000000000000 r12 = 0x00000001225b64e0
05:58:14 INFO - r13 = 0x00000000ffffffff r14 = 0x0000000000000000
05:58:14 INFO - r15 = 0x0000000132662700 rip = 0x00000001015b5811
05:58:14 INFO - rsp = 0x00007fff5fbfce60 rbp = 0x00007fff5fbfcf50
05:58:14 INFO - Found by: call frame info
05:58:14 INFO - 7 XUL!imgRequestProxy::RemoveFromLoadGroup(bool) [imgRequestProxy.cpp:76666ba94d14 : 255 + 0xf]
05:58:14 INFO - rbx = 0x0000000132662700 r12 = 0x00000001005158b0
05:58:14 INFO - r13 = 0x00007fff5fbfd087 r14 = 0x0000000000000001
05:58:14 INFO - r15 = 0x0000000132662758 rip = 0x00000001020ccea3
05:58:14 INFO - rsp = 0x00007fff5fbfcf60 rbp = 0x00007fff5fbfcf80
05:58:14 INFO - Found by: call frame info
05:58:14 INFO - 8 XUL!nsRunnableMethodImpl<void (imgRequestProxy::*)(), void, true>::Run() [nsThreadUtils.h:76666ba94d14 : 386 + 0x15]
05:58:14 INFO - rbx = 0x00000001005158b0 r12 = 0x00000001005158b0
05:58:14 INFO - r13 = 0x00007fff5fbfd087 r14 = 0x0000000000000000
05:58:14 INFO - r15 = 0x0000000000b08b00 rip = 0x00000001020d3836
05:58:14 INFO - rsp = 0x00007fff5fbfcf90 rbp = 0x00007fff5fbfcf90
05:58:14 INFO - Found by: call frame info
05:58:14 INFO - 9 XUL!nsThread::ProcessNextEvent(bool, bool*) [nsThread.cpp:76666ba94d14 : 855 + 0x5]
05:58:14 INFO - rbx = 0x00000001005158b0 r12 = 0x00000001005158b0
05:58:14 INFO - r13 = 0x00007fff5fbfd087 r14 = 0x0000000000000000
05:58:14 INFO - r15 = 0x0000000000b08b00 rip = 0x00000001014fc1c4
05:58:14 INFO - rsp = 0x00007fff5fbfcfa0 rbp = 0x00007fff5fbfd070
05:58:14 INFO - Found by: call frame info
05:58:14 INFO - 10 XUL!NS_ProcessPendingEvents(nsIThread*, unsigned int) [nsThreadUtils.cpp:76666ba94d14 : 207 + 0xe]
05:58:14 INFO - rbx = 0x0000000000000000 r12 = 0x00000001005158b0
05:58:14 INFO - r13 = 0x00007fff5fbfd087 r14 = 0x0000000000000014
05:58:14 INFO - r15 = 0x0000000000b08bc9 rip = 0x00000001015289fd
05:58:14 INFO - rsp = 0x00007fff5fbfd080 rbp = 0x00007fff5fbfd0b0
05:58:14 INFO - Found by: call frame info
Flags: needinfo?(seth)
Whiteboard: [gfx-noted]
Summary: Intermittent test_draggableprop.html | application crashed [@ mozalloc_abort(char const*)] after "ABORT: Should have given mProgressTracker to mImage: '!mProgressTracker', file /image/src/imgRequest.cpp, line 149" → Intermittent test_draggableprop.html,test_richtext2.html | application crashed [@ mozalloc_abort(char const*)] after "ABORT: Should have given mProgressTracker to mImage: '!mProgressTracker', file /image/src/imgRequest.cpp, line 149"
I'm being told that there's little to no chance of the patches that fixed these once and for all making it to 37/38. Guess I'll start disabling my way to victory.
Flags: needinfo?(seth)
Assignee: nobody → seth
Depends on: 1137002
Target Milestone: --- → mozilla39
Flags: needinfo?(ryanvm)
Inactive; closing (see bug 1180138).
Status: NEW → RESOLVED
Closed: 9 years ago
Resolution: --- → WORKSFORME
You need to log in before you can comment on or make changes to this bug.